Abstract

Beneficiation and physical and chemical processing of non-terrestrial materials borrow strongly from terrestrial experience, but also involve the necessity of handling literally un-Earthly feedstocks, reagents, and environmental conditions. The present state of scientific and engineering understanding of the processing of non-terrestrial minerals, gases and hydrocarbons is reviewed with the production of rocket propellants, life-support fluids, structural metals, and refractories as the goal.
